In this video, which is a part of my series, ITALIAN CLASSIC MOVIES THAT YOU NEED TO KNOW, I review THE DAMNED, Directed by Luchino Visconti. The film starred Helmut Berger, Dirk Bogarde, Charlotte Rampling and Ingrid Thulin!
In my review I explain how Visconti puts you right through the evil of the rise of Nazi's in Germany in the 1930's and why it's so effective emotionally, yet very challenging to watch.
